pgj 2009-01-07 09:18:54 UTC FreeBSD doc repository Modified files: en_US.ISO8859-1/books/handbook/cutting-edge chapter.sgml Log: Add a section on updating the documentation set. It describes some methods for updating, like using CVSup and rebuilding the documentation from source, and using Docsnap. Of course, other methods can be added later on, you can think of it as a stub for such methods. Note: The sub-section about Docsnap is temporarly disabled as there is no active Docsnap server at the moment.
